Job Summary:

The QUALITY SPECIALIST will be responsible for implementing, improving, and maintaining the Food Safety and Quality Management Systems in alignment with the company’s policies and relevant certifications. This includes ensuring compliance with regulatory and customer expectations related to food safety and quality. The Technician will monitor the quality of raw materials and finished products to ensure that quality standards are consistently met, contributing to customer satisfaction and operational excellence. You will also be a part of the vital team implementing policies necessary to achieve FSSC 22000 certification by 2026.



Essential Duties & Responsibilities:
  • Perform routine quality checks on finished products and packaging, ensuring compliance with internal and customer specifications.
  • Maintain proper records and ensure production staff properly records any anomalies.
  • Review Certificates of Analysis (COAs) and perform quality checks on raw materials to verify supplier specification adherence, reporting any discrepancies to management.
  • Implement and maintain food safety and quality assurance policies in accordance with Group Lacroix policies, regulatory requirements, customer expectations, and FSSC 22000 standards.
  • Monitor micro and environmental analysis to maintain appropriate food contact conditions in the production environment.
  • Collect and analyze data for Statistical Process Control (SPC), supporting operations to maintain high quality and food safety standards, and recommend improvements as needed.
  • Troubleshoot quality issues, conducting root cause analysis and ensuring proper handling of non-conforming products.
  • Investigate, trend, and resolve customer complaints, ensuring proper communication of resolutions.
  • Coach and train new and existing employees on food safety and quality standards.
  • Ensure compliance with Prerequisite Programs, HACCP, FSSC, and other food safety regulations.
  • Lead the Food Safety Team and participate in the annual HACCP review process.
  • Conduct plant inspections, assist with periodic internal audits, and monitor adherence to Good Manufacturing Practices (GMPs), including hygiene and attire standards.
  • Prepare for and assist in third-party or customer audits.
  • Maintain a strong presence on the production floor, spending the majority of time working directly with operators, technicians, and quality control team members to ensure standards are met.
